Clear Radiata Pine wood is highly valued for its versatility and workability. Here are some key characteristics:
Appearance: The heartwood is light brown, while the sapwood is a paler yellowish-white. Clear Radiata Pine is known for being knot-free, which makes it particularly desirable for many applications.
Grain and Texture: It has a straight grain with a medium, even texture, making it easy to work with both hand and machine tools.
Durability: The heartwood is rated as non-durable to perishable in terms of decay resistance. However, the sapwood can be treated with preservatives for exterior use.
Workability: Radiata Pine is easy to cut, shape, and finish. It holds screws and nails well, making it a favorite among carpenters and woodworkers.
Uses: Commonly used for veneer, plywood, paper (pulpwood), boxes/crates, and construction lumber.
